Help with downloading documents

Documents on this website are available for download in various formats.

If you cannot access documents on the site, you may not have the correct software installed.

Links to free readers are provided below. By downloading and installing these programmes on your computer, you should be able to open the documents.

File types and viewers

Portable Document Format (PDF)

Many documents on the website are available in Portable Document Format (PDF).

To view these files you will need to download and install the free Acrobat Reader.

Rich Text Format (.rtf)

To view Rich Text Format files you will need a text reader.

For example, see TextMaker Viewer 2008.
